Overview
Embark on a comprehensive fullstack tutorial to build a MERN Stack project from start to finish. Explore the components of the MERN stack and learn how to utilize each element to create a real-world fullstack application. Begin with an introduction to the MERN stack, understanding the concept of full stack development, and the distinction between frontend and backend. Dive into REST APIs, CRUD operations, and HTTP methods. Follow along as the instructor guides you through project planning, user story creation, and the installation of Node.js and npm. Learn to set up a basic Node.js and Express server, implement request routing, and handle bad requests. Gain valuable insights into building robust web applications using MongoDB, Express, React, and Node.js technologies.
Syllabus
Intro
Welcome
What is the MERN Stack?
What does full stack mean?
Frontend vs Backend
What is a REST API?
CRUD and HTTP Methods
Suggested Pre-requisites for this course
What we're building with MERN
User Stories - Project Planning
Installing Node.js and npm
Create a basic Node.js and Express server
Basic request routing setup
Routing bad requests
LTS actually means "Long Term Support". I had "latest" on the brain from updating npm packages :
Taught by
Dave Gray